Output 8963b85627e03b417526c25915023f6aeff09ba18ff710f716cbc953fa85cee5:0

value
624032053
script pubkey
OP_HASH160 OP_PUSHBYTES_20 902e7e54548742e07b96a05365c87fd538f431f6 OP_EQUAL
address
3EqNvbCu24Lzqx33g2KNZ84B2R5smnRs9g
transaction
8963b85627e03b417526c25915023f6aeff09ba18ff710f716cbc953fa85cee5
spent
true